import pytz

from django.core.exceptions import ValidationError

from registrasion.models import commerce
from registrasion.models import conditions
from registrasion.controllers.category import CategoryController
from registrasion.tests.controller_helpers import TestingCartController
from registrasion.tests.controller_helpers import TestingInvoiceController
from registrasion.controllers.product import ProductController

from registrasion.tests.test_cart import RegistrationCartTestCase

UTC = pytz.timezone('UTC')


class FlagTestCases(RegistrationCartTestCase):

    @classmethod
    def add_product_flag(cls, condition=conditions.FlagBase.ENABLE_IF_TRUE):
        ''' Adds a product flag condition: adding PROD_1 to a cart is
        predicated on adding PROD_2 beforehand. '''
        flag = conditions.ProductFlag.objects.create(
            description="Product condition",
            condition=condition,
        )
        flag.products.add(cls.PROD_1)
        flag.enabling_products.add(cls.PROD_2)

    @classmethod
    def add_product_flag_on_category(
            cls,
            condition=conditions.FlagBase.ENABLE_IF_TRUE,
            ):
        ''' Adds a product flag condition that operates on a category:
        adding an item from CAT_1 is predicated on adding PROD_3 beforehand '''
        flag = conditions.ProductFlag.objects.create(
            description="Product condition",
            condition=condition,
        )
        flag.categories.add(cls.CAT_1)
        flag.enabling_products.add(cls.PROD_3)

    def add_category_flag(cls, condition=conditions.FlagBase.ENABLE_IF_TRUE):
        ''' Adds a category flag condition: adding PROD_1 to a cart is
        predicated on adding an item from CAT_2 beforehand.'''
        flag = conditions.CategoryFlag.objects.create(
            description="Category condition",
            condition=condition,
            enabling_category=cls.CAT_2,
        )
        flag.products.add(cls.PROD_1)

    def test_product_flag_enables_product(self):
        self.add_product_flag()

        # Cannot buy PROD_1 without buying PROD_2
        current_cart = TestingCartController.for_user(self.USER_1)
        with self.assertRaises(ValidationError):
            current_cart.add_to_cart(self.PROD_1, 1)

        current_cart.add_to_cart(self.PROD_2, 1)
        current_cart.add_to_cart(self.PROD_1, 1)

    def test_product_enabled_by_product_in_previous_cart(self):
        self.add_product_flag()

        current_cart = TestingCartController.for_user(self.USER_1)
        current_cart.add_to_cart(self.PROD_2, 1)

        current_cart.next_cart()

        # Create new cart and try to add PROD_1
        current_cart = TestingCartController.for_user(self.USER_1)
        current_cart.add_to_cart(self.PROD_1, 1)

    def test_product_flag_enables_category(self):
        self.add_product_flag_on_category()

        # Cannot buy PROD_1 without buying item from CAT_2
        current_cart = TestingCartController.for_user(self.USER_1)
        with self.assertRaises(ValidationError):
            current_cart.add_to_cart(self.PROD_1, 1)

        current_cart.add_to_cart(self.PROD_3, 1)
        current_cart.add_to_cart(self.PROD_1, 1)

    def test_category_flag_enables_product(self):
        self.add_category_flag()

        # Cannot buy PROD_1 without buying PROD_2
        current_cart = TestingCartController.for_user(self.USER_1)
        with self.assertRaises(ValidationError):
            current_cart.add_to_cart(self.PROD_1, 1)

        # PROD_3 is in CAT_2
        current_cart.add_to_cart(self.PROD_3, 1)
        current_cart.add_to_cart(self.PROD_1, 1)

    def test_product_enabled_by_category_in_previous_cart(self):
        self.add_category_flag()

        current_cart = TestingCartController.for_user(self.USER_1)
        current_cart.add_to_cart(self.PROD_3, 1)

        current_cart.next_cart()

        # Create new cart and try to add PROD_1
        current_cart = TestingCartController.for_user(self.USER_1)
        current_cart.add_to_cart(self.PROD_1, 1)

    def test_multiple_eit_conditions(self):
        self.add_product_flag()
        self.add_category_flag()

        # User 1 is testing the product flag condition
        cart_1 = TestingCartController.for_user(self.USER_1)
        # Cannot add PROD_1 until a condition is met
        with self.assertRaises(ValidationError):
            cart_1.add_to_cart(self.PROD_1, 1)
        cart_1.add_to_cart(self.PROD_2, 1)
        cart_1.add_to_cart(self.PROD_1, 1)

        # User 2 is testing the category flag condition
        cart_2 = TestingCartController.for_user(self.USER_2)
        # Cannot add PROD_1 until a condition is met
        with self.assertRaises(ValidationError):
            cart_2.add_to_cart(self.PROD_1, 1)
        cart_2.add_to_cart(self.PROD_3, 1)
        cart_2.add_to_cart(self.PROD_1, 1)

    def test_multiple_dif_conditions(self):
        self.add_product_flag(condition=conditions.FlagBase.DISABLE_IF_FALSE)
        self.add_category_flag(condition=conditions.FlagBase.DISABLE_IF_FALSE)

        cart_1 = TestingCartController.for_user(self.USER_1)
        # Cannot add PROD_1 until both conditions are met
        with self.assertRaises(ValidationError):
            cart_1.add_to_cart(self.PROD_1, 1)
        cart_1.add_to_cart(self.PROD_2, 1)  # Meets the product condition
        with self.assertRaises(ValidationError):
            cart_1.add_to_cart(self.PROD_1, 1)
        cart_1.add_to_cart(self.PROD_3, 1)  # Meets the category condition
        cart_1.add_to_cart(self.PROD_1, 1)

    def test_eit_and_dif_conditions_work_together(self):
        self.add_product_flag(condition=conditions.FlagBase.ENABLE_IF_TRUE)
        self.add_category_flag(condition=conditions.FlagBase.DISABLE_IF_FALSE)

        cart_1 = TestingCartController.for_user(self.USER_1)
        # Cannot add PROD_1 until both conditions are met
        with self.assertRaises(ValidationError):
            cart_1.add_to_cart(self.PROD_1, 1)

        cart_1.add_to_cart(self.PROD_2, 1)  # Meets the EIT condition

        # Need to meet both conditions before you can add
        with self.assertRaises(ValidationError):
            cart_1.add_to_cart(self.PROD_1, 1)

        cart_1.set_quantity(self.PROD_2, 0)  # Un-meets the EIT condition

        cart_1.add_to_cart(self.PROD_3, 1)  # Meets the DIF condition

        # Need to meet both conditions before you can add
        with self.assertRaises(ValidationError):
            cart_1.add_to_cart(self.PROD_1, 1)

        cart_1.add_to_cart(self.PROD_2, 1)  # Meets the EIT condition

        # Now that both conditions are met, we can add the product
        cart_1.add_to_cart(self.PROD_1, 1)
